You may well ask why a nutritionist – I eat well enough?

The answer is simple. Food today is not what it was 2 generations ago. The cocktail of additives, colours, preservatives, thickening agents etc that are in modern foods are being added faster than we can adapt. Couple with that the fact that food is not as nutrient rich as it used to be, lack of variety in ingredients and many processing methods actually remove nutrients, many people find they have an ever increasing range of illnesses and sensitivities.

Considering the old adage that ‘all diseases stem from the gut’, it is no surprise how many people simply don’t feel well.

A nutritionist is skilled in reviewing your diet and identify areas that are lacking may be lacking. This skill is coupled with an understanding of many diseases and conditions and they can be treated with nutritional support in the forms of foods and dietary supplements.

With food sensitivities on the rise, it makes good sense to get your nutritional intake checked.
